Saving money often sounds like a task meant only for people with big incomes or detailed budgets. But the truth is, you don’t need to start big to start right. With small steps and a pressure-free mindset, anyone can build the habit of saving and slowly move toward financial comfort. Let Go of the Idea of ‘Perfect’ Saving One reason many people avoid saving is the belief that they need to set aside a large amount right away. This can be overwhelming and discouraging. But savings don’t have to be perfect. They just need to be consistent. Even saving ₹20 or ₹50 a day adds up over time. When you allow yourself to start small, saving becomes approachable. It’s better to save ₹500 a month regularly than to wait until you can afford ₹5,000 and never start at all. Start with What You Have Look at your current income and expenses.
